You must file a final return for the year you close your business. The type of return you file – and related forms you need – will depend on the type of business you have. A limited liability company (LLC) is a business organized under state law. WebMar 1, 2024 · What is Form 941? IRS Form 941, Employer’s Quarterly Federal Tax Return, reports payroll taxes and employee wages to the IRS. Talk to your accountant, tax advisor, IRS or state … khiron forum wallstreetWebApr 9, 2024 · Form 941 is due by the last day of the month following the end of each quarter. For example, if you close your business May 15, 20xx (the second quarter), file Form 941 no later than July 31, 20xx. Complete Part 3 on page 2 of Form 941, and enter the final date wages were paid. 2. Form 940, Employer's Annual Federal Unemployment … khiri bryant wife picturesis lithium non renewable
